UHAS 2018 ADMISSION OPEN FOR MPHIL / PHD PROGRAMMMES IN MEDICAL IMAGING APPLICANTS

It is announced for the information of prospective Applicants (as specified above) and the general public that E-Vouchers for application forms for postgraduate programmes in Medical Imaging for 2018/2019 Admissions are now on sale at GHC 220.00
1. MASTER OF PHILOSOPHY (MPHIL) IN MEDICAL IMAGING
The MPhil programme has two pathways; a two (2) year Full-Time (Regular) and a three year Part-Time (sandwich) options. Students are to choose the format that best suits them. The first academic year for regular candidates will consist of taught courses which will be run in two semesters. The timeline for the full time (regular) format will run from August to June and for Part-Time students, the first year will consist of two long vacations (June – August). Each long vacation period will be equivalent to one semester for the part-time programme. The second year is full time non-residential, which will focus mainly on research work. Students will undertake independent research study presented in the form of thesis with a word count not exceeding 50,000 words. Successful completion of the research component of the programme is a partial fulfilment of the requirements leading to the award of a Master of Philosophy degree in Medical Imaging. The minimum and maximum period for completing the programme shall be four and eight semesters (2 to 4 years) respectively.
ENTRY REQUIREMENTS FOR MPHIL

  • Applicants must hold a first degree (at least 2nd class lower or 2.2 GPA) in Medical Imaging (Diagnostic/therapy Radiography), Nuclear Medicine or related MI area from a recognised University.
  • Applicants must have at least two years work experience as a diagnostic or therapy radiographer, mammographer, sonographer or other related MI specialties.
  • Two reference statements/letters from professional and/or academic referees
  • Applicants must pass an admission interview
  • Ghanaian and foreign applicants are eligible to apply

2. DOCTOR OF PHILOSOPHY (PHD)
The PhD programme is a four (4) year full-time or six years part-time (sandwich)] one. In the first academic year, candidates will undertake taught courses. This will enable them identify areas of research interest in medical imaging to conduct their research. The second year will consist of experiential learning, workshops and a series of research seminars. The final two years will focus mainly on research work that will be presented in the form of thesis with a word count not exceeding 100,000 words. The minimum and maximum period for completing the programme shall be eight and twelve semesters (4 to 6 years) respectively.
ENTRY REQUIREMENTS FOR PHD

  • Applicants must hold an MPhil or MSc. in Medical Imaging, Therapy Radiography, Nuclear Medicine or related MI area from a recognised University.
  • Applicants must have at least three years work experience as a diagnostic or therapy radiographer, mammographer, sonographer or other related MI specialties.
  • Two reference statements/letters from professional and/or academic referees.
  • Applicants must pass an admission interview
  • Ghanaian and foreign applicants are eligible to apply
  • Research proposal (not more than 700 words)
  • Statement of purpose (not more than 500 words)
